Facilities Manager - Cheltenham (Full Office-Based)

Location: CheltenhamSalary: Very Competitive

We're seeking an experienced Facilities Manager to take full ownership of the day-to-day running of our Cheltenham office, leading a small team and managing key supplier relationships to ensure the workplace runs smoothly, efficiently, and safely.

This is a soft facilities management position ideal for someone who enjoys variety, autonomy, and being at the heart of an office community. You'll work closely with regional Facilities Managers and the Head of Facilities (based in London), contributing to a range of operational and project-based initiatives.

Key Responsibilities

As Facilities Manager, you'll play a vital role in maintaining a high-performing, well-run office environment. Your key duties will include:

Managing the Facilities Helpdesk - overseeing queries related to building maintenance, access, and general operations.Coordinating contractors and suppliers - maintaining strong relationships to ensure quality service delivery across M&E, cleaning, and stationery contracts.Supporting daily operations - including meeting room setups, weekend works, and office moves.Budget and finance management - assisting with OPEX and CAPEX budgets, reviewing invoices, and maintaining accurate reporting.Ensuring compliance - upholding Health & Safety, GDPR, and environmental standards (ISO 14001).Leading and supporting the team - conducting regular one-to-ones, providing coaching, and maintaining a positive, professional working environment.Event and project support - partnering with Marketing, DE&I, and wider Facilities colleagues on local and firmwide initiatives.
